About The Position

The Executive Assistant provides professional support to the Chief Financial Officer, which includes project management as well as administrative support responsibilities. Will be expected to independently set-up and manage the appointed office and administration functions. A proactive and solution-oriented mindset, and a quest for continuous improvement is essential. Maintain focus on timeliness and execution of tasks and deliverables every day.

Responsibilities

  • Provide administrative services to the CFO and his team of direct reports
  • Coordinate with the CFO and leadership group about any special projects, assignments, and company events
  • Provide administrative services for projects that are consistent with corporate goals and objectives
  • Responsible for management of day-to-day operations including schedules, correspondence, e-mail, phones, purchase requests, travel arrangements, presentations, etc.
  • Schedule appointments, conference calls, and coordinate arrangements for meetings
  • Support event planning as requested
  • Prepare various reports
  • Order and maintain supplies
  • Organize necessary office/desk moves for department
  • Prepare and process routine forms, documents, correspondence, expense reports, requisitions, purchase orders, etc. following standard procedures
  • Organize and maintain file system, prepare copies of correspondence and other written materials. In some cases, records may be of a highly confidential nature requiring discretion.
  • Work collaboratively to achieve goals and/or complete assigned tasks
